Redwing

Scientific name : Turdus iliacus
Other names: Български: Беловежд дрозд , Brezhoneg: Drask-lann , Català: Tord ala-roig , Česky: Drozd cvrčala , Dansk: Vindrossel , Deutsch: Rotdrossel , Esperanto: Ruĝaksela turdo , Español: Zorzal alirrojo , Eesti: Vainurästas , Basque: Birigarro txiki , Suomi: Punakylkirastas , Français: Grive mauvis , Magyar: Szőlőrigó , Italiano: Tordo sassello , 日本語: ワキアカツグミ , Lietuviškai: Baltabruvis strazdas , Latviešu: Plukšķis , Nederlands: Koperwiek , Norsk (nynorsk): Raudvengtrast , Norsk: Rødvingetrost , Polski: Droździk , Português: Tordo-ruivo , Русский: Белобровик , Svenska: Rödvingetrast , Türkçe: Kızıl ardıç kuşu

Short Description

Redwings have rusty-red under wings and flanks, a dark streaking on the breast and a bright white stripe over the eyes. Their top is brown. Males and females do not differ.
